The 1960-61 Ice hockey Bundesliga season was the third season of the Ice hockey Bundesliga, the top level of ice hockey in Germany. Eight teams participated in the league, and EV Fussen won the championship.

Regular season

Club GP W T L GF-GA Pts
1. EV Füssen 28 22 4 2 176:57 48:8
2. EC Bad Tölz 28 21 3 4 121:53 45:11
3. SC Riessersee (M) 28 19 2 7 144:79 40:16
4. Krefelder EV 28 13 3 12 119:108 29:27
5. Mannheimer ERC 28 10 2 16 91:109 22:34
6. Preußen Krefeld 28 10 2 16 97:137 22:34
7. TSC Eintracht Dortmund (N) 28 8 0 20 73:128 16:40
8. VfL Bad Nauheim 28 1 0 27 53:203 2:54
